What is One-Stop Permitting?

One-Stop permitting only applies to residential permits and allows applicants to apply for and obtain permits in a quick and convenient manner. Per the Florida Building Code, each One-Stop permit is designed to be processed without Plan Review Approval. One-stop permit applications can typically be processed, approved and issued in a relatively short timeframe while the applicant waits, therefore increasing efficiency and reducing customer visits. Please see the following list of permit type’s eligible for One-Stop Permitting:

Residential

• Re-roof without skylights or ISO (insulation) Board installation

• Fence

• Mechanical change-out, no ductwork replacement

• Pool resurfacing

• Tree Removal
